Conversione efficiente da JPM a PSD utilizzando GroupDocs.Conversion per .NET
Introduzione
Desideri ottimizzare i tuoi processi di conversione dei file? Questa guida completa ti guiderà nella conversione dei file JPM in formato PSD utilizzando la potente API GroupDocs.Conversion per .NET. Che tu sia uno sviluppatore alla ricerca di soluzioni efficienti o un’azienda che mira a semplificare i flussi di lavoro documentali, questo strumento offre funzionalità robuste e su misura per le esigenze moderne.
In questo tutorial, ci concentreremo sull’implementazione della conversione di file con precisione e semplicità, utilizzando la libreria GroupDocs.Conversion per .NET. Seguendo le istruzioni, imparerai a impostare ed eseguire le conversioni in modo efficace, assicurandoti che la tua applicazione gestisca diversi formati di immagine senza intoppi. Cosa imparerai:
- Impostazione di GroupDocs.Conversion per .NET
- Caricamento dei file JPM di origine
- Configurazione delle opzioni di conversione in formato PSD
- Esecuzione della conversione del file
- Esplorazione delle applicazioni pratiche e considerazioni sulle prestazioni Vediamo come raggiungere questi obiettivi con facilità. Prima di iniziare, assicurati che il tuo ambiente sia configurato correttamente.
Prerequisiti
Per seguire questo tutorial in modo efficace, è necessario soddisfare alcuni requisiti di base:
Librerie, versioni e dipendenze richieste
Assicurati di avere quanto segue:
- .NET Framework 4.6.1 o versione successiva
- GroupDocs.Conversion per .NET versione 25.3.0
Requisiti di configurazione dell’ambiente
- Un ambiente di sviluppo come Visual Studio installato sul computer.
- Accesso alla directory in cui sono archiviati i file JPM.
Prerequisiti di conoscenza
Una conoscenza di base del linguaggio C# e la familiarità con le operazioni di I/O sui file saranno utili, anche se non strettamente necessarie, poiché in questa guida tratteremo i principi fondamentali.
Impostazione di GroupDocs.Conversion per .NET
Per iniziare a utilizzare GroupDocs.Conversion nel tuo progetto, devi prima installarlo. Ecco come fare: Console del gestore pacchetti NuGet
Install-Package GroupDocs.Conversion -Version 25.3.0
Interfaccia a riga di comando .NET
dotnet add package GroupDocs.Conversion --version 25.3.0
Fasi di acquisizione della licenza
GroupDocs offre diverse opzioni di licenza:
- Prova gratuita: Accedi alle funzionalità complete per un periodo limitato per valutare l’API.
- Licenza temporanea: Richiedi una licenza temporanea se hai bisogno di più tempo per la valutazione.
- Acquistare: Acquisisci una licenza permanente per l’uso in produzione. Per iniziare la tua prova gratuita, visita Prova gratuita di GroupDocs.
Inizializzazione e configurazione di base
Una volta installato, inizializza il motore di conversione con questa configurazione di base:
using System;
using GroupDocs.Conversion;
// Inizializza l'oggetto Converter
global using (Converter converter = new Converter("YOUR_DOCUMENT_DIRECTORY/SAMPLE_JPM"))
{
// La configurazione seguirà...
}
Guida all’implementazione
Impostazione della conversione dei file
Questa funzionalità illustra come impostare il processo di conversione dal formato JPM a PSD. Include la definizione di una directory di output e di un modello per la denominazione dei file convertiti.
Definisci directory di output
Imposta la cartella di output desiderata in cui verranno salvati i file convertiti:
string outputFolder = "YOUR_OUTPUT_DIRECTORY";
Denominazione dei modelli per i file convertiti
Creare una funzione che generi percorsi di file in modo dinamico in base ai risultati della conversione:
string outputFileTemplate = Path.Combine(outputFolder, "converted-page-{0}.psd");
Func<SavePageContext, Stream> getPageStream = savePageContext => new FileStream(string.Format(outputFileTemplate, savePageContext.Page), FileMode.Create);
Caricamento del file sorgente
Carica il tuo file JPM sorgente per la conversione utilizzando Converter
classe.
Inizializza il convertitore con il file sorgente
global using (Converter converter = new Converter("YOUR_DOCUMENT_DIRECTORY/SAMPLE_JPM"))
{
// La configurazione della conversione verrà implementata successivamente...
}
Impostazione delle opzioni di conversione
Configura le opzioni necessarie per convertire un’immagine dal formato JPM a PSD.
Definisci le opzioni di conversione delle immagini
Imposta il formato del file di destinazione e altri parametri rilevanti:
ImageConvertOptions options = new ImageConvertOptions { Format = GroupDocs.Conversion.FileTypes.ImageFileType.Psd };
Esecuzione della conversione dei file
Eseguire la conversione utilizzando opzioni predefinite e una funzione di flusso di output.
Esegui conversione
Eseguire la conversione effettiva del file con il Convert
metodo:
current.Convert(getPageStream, options);
Applicazioni pratiche
GroupDocs.Conversion per .NET può essere utilizzato in vari scenari reali:
- Flussi di lavoro di progettazione grafica: Converti i file JPM in PSD per modificarli in Adobe Photoshop.
- Sistemi di archiviazione automatizzati: Semplificare i processi di conversione dei documenti all’interno dei sistemi di archiviazione.
- Piattaforme di gestione dei contenuti: Integrare le funzionalità di conversione dei file nei CMS, migliorando la flessibilità nella gestione dei media.
- Progetti di migrazione dei dati: Facilita le transizioni del formato delle immagini durante le attività di migrazione dei dati.
- Strumenti di reporting personalizzati: Incorpora conversioni di immagini per supportare la generazione di report dinamici.
Considerazioni sulle prestazioni
Quando si utilizza GroupDocs.Conversion per .NET, tenere presente questi suggerimenti per ottimizzare le prestazioni:
- Gestione delle risorse: Garantire un uso efficiente della memoria disponendo correttamente gli oggetti dopo la conversione.
- Elaborazione batch: Gestisci più conversioni di file in batch per ridurre i costi generali e migliorare la produttività.
- Ottimizzazione della configurazione: Adatta le impostazioni di conversione in base alle esigenze specifiche per migliorare la velocità e l’utilizzo delle risorse.
Conclusione
In questo tutorial, abbiamo illustrato come configurare ed eseguire conversioni da JPM a PSD utilizzando GroupDocs.Conversion per .NET. Seguendo i passaggi descritti, è possibile integrare perfettamente le funzionalità di conversione dei file nelle applicazioni, migliorandone la funzionalità e l’esperienza utente. Prossimi passi:
- Prova i diversi formati di file supportati da GroupDocs.Conversion.
- Esplora le funzionalità aggiuntive dell’API, come l’unione e la divisione dei documenti. Pronti a portare la vostra applicazione al livello successivo? Iniziate a implementare queste soluzioni oggi stesso!
Sezione FAQ
- Quali sono i requisiti di sistema per utilizzare GroupDocs.Conversion per .NET?
- È richiesto .NET Framework 4.6.1 o versione successiva. Assicurarsi che l’ambiente di sviluppo soddisfi questo criterio.
- Posso convertire file diversi dalle immagini con GroupDocs.Conversion?
- Sì, supporta un’ampia gamma di formati di documenti, tra cui PDF, documenti Word e altro ancora.
- Come posso gestire in modo efficiente le conversioni di file di grandi dimensioni?
- Utilizzare l’elaborazione in batch e ottimizzare l’utilizzo della memoria per gestire efficacemente le risorse durante le attività di conversione.
- Esiste il supporto per la conversione di file in blocco?
- Certamente, GroupDocs.Conversion consente di elaborare più file contemporaneamente, risparmiando tempo e fatica.
- Dove posso trovare maggiori informazioni sulle funzionalità e gli aggiornamenti dell’API?
- Visita il Documentazione di GroupDocs per guide e risorse complete.